Christian E. Pederson
Christian E. Pederson is an associate in the Grand Rapids, Michigan, office of Jackson Lewis P.C. His practice focuses on representing employers in workplace law matters, including preventive advice and counseling.
Christian is a member of the firm's Litigation practice group. He represents employers in various employment law and labor matters including claims of discrimination, harassment, and retaliation brought under Title VII, the ADA, the ADEA, and the ELCRA.
Prior to joining Jackson Lewis, Christian practiced in Grand Rapids, Michigan at a boutique litigation firm where he focused his skills on employment law, as well as commercial, business, and probate litigation matters.
During law school, Christian participated in the Sherman Minton Moot Court competition where he received Brief Writing Honors. Christian's student note, "The Impact of the Exhaustion of Rights Doctrine on Parallel Imports and International Trade", was published by the Indiana Journal of Global Legal Studies, where he served as a Notes Editor.
